Bitcoin Faces Bearish Trends Amidst Macroeconomic Pressures
As September 2025 unfolds, Bitcoin finds itself grappling with a series of bearish signals. A critical doji candlestick below the pivotal $112,000 mark has raised concerns about weak selling pressure exacerbated by disappointing Non-Farm Payrolls data. This bearish sentiment is compounded by an oversold Relative Strength Index (RSI) dipping below 30, suggesting potential bottoming but also highlighting recent struggles to break past $115,000 sustainably. Meanwhile, the U.S. Dollar's strength and predictions of a Federal Reserve rate cut add layers of uncertainty to Bitcoin's trajectory, given its traditional inverse correlation with the dollar. These developments underscore the importance for investors to adopt strategic hedging measures, balancing gold and stablecoin allocations alongside Bitcoin.
Altcoins Surge as Regulatory Clarity Fuels Market Shift
In contrast to Bitcoin's volatile journey, altcoins are enjoying robust growth in Q3 2025. According to recent research, factors such as regulatory clarity from U.S. legislative actions have invigorated interest in alternative cryptocurrencies like Ethereum, Solana, and Avalanche. The introduction of not just regulatory compliance but also technological advancements propels these digital assets forward; Solana’s superior speed attracts developers while Ethereum benefits from scalability improvements through Layer 2 solutions. Moreover, institutional interests are now aligning with decentralized finance innovations and AI integrations as captured by revamped investment strategies that include new entrants like Livepeer and Cardano.

Strategic Investments Balance Volatility with Long-Term Growth
Investors adopting strategic diversification are witnessing a shift in portfolio dynamics where balance between stalwart assets like Bitcoin and emerging altcoins is crucial. Institutional adoption is boosted by streamlined ETF approvals which have notably reduced market volatility—yet remained poised for further growth spikes. With the SEC shortening approval timelines for crypto-related ETFs dramatically this year, the influx of capital into cryptocurrency markets persists unabatedly—adding about $54 billion so far this year alone.
